New trade missions to Korea, Japan set

- Advertisement -

The Philippines will hold separate trade and investment meetings with Korea and Japan on the second and third week of December to follow up earlier discussions.

“We’re looking forward for big investments from these two countries,” Trade Secretary Ramon Lopez said at the sidelines of the two-day Livelihood and Employment Summit held recently in Taguig City.

The Korean leg, Lopez said, was an effort to draw in more Korean investors into the Philippines.

The department, meanwhile, will meet with the Bank of Tokyo on the third week for possible cooperation on wholesale financing.

President Rodrigo Duterte made several state visits and trade missions to Asia, bringing home $24 billion of pledges and assistance from China.

Another trade and investment mission will be launched in Russia by early 2017.
